@charset "UTF-8";

#line_links + .contents_btn01 a:after{
    background: #7AD77A;
}
#line_links + .contents_btn01 a:before{
    background: #C3E8C3;
}
#line_links + .contents_btn01 a span {
    display: flex;
    align-items: center;
    justify-content: flex-start;
    padding: 0 19px 0 5px
}
#line_links + .contents_btn01 a span img {
    width: 32px;
    height: auto;
    margin: 16px;
}
@media only screen and (max-width: 900px) {
    #line_links + .contents_btn01 a span img {
        width: 40px;
        margin: 20px;
    }
}